Along similar lines, I recently learned about an early nuclear physics textbook written by George Gamow. The first edition came out in 1931, and the preface of the second edition in 1937 describes how the book had to be completely written because the state of knowledge had changed so radically in those few years -- most notably, by the discovery of the neutron and of induced radioactivity. > It wouldn’t surprise me if at some point in the future we realise mass shields us from a gravitational field that pushes everything in all directions at once as opposed to our current thinking that mass emits a field that pulls us towards it.

It would definitely surprise me since I know that this theory — since it's such an obvious hypothesis — has been proposed multiple times since Newton's own (it's now colloquially called "Le Sage's theory of gravitation" [0], but it had many other proponents including Kelvin, H. Lorentz and Thomson) and it has always failed to accomodate the equivalence of graviational and inertional masses: after all, the gravity is not proportional to the cross-section of the bodies, and graviational shielding does not exist — experiments done by Eötvös were quite decisive in that regard.

Charge carriers aren't always electrons anyway, so you're restricting yourself by thinking of current as electrons moving. Even in the usual case where electrons are the charge carrier, it is only the small net movement of zillions of electrons back and forth which produces a current. So in any case current is a macrostate and electron movement is a microstate, and sign convention won't change that.
